Rapid Application Development Model in Software Engineering

Rapid Application Development (RAD) is an agile methodology for software development that emphasizes speed and active user participation, in contrast to traditional sequential methods. It focuses on rapidly creating and enhancing functional prototypes driven by ongoing user feedback. This approach results in shorter development timelines, faster market launch, and the ability to adjust to evolving requirements, culminating in a product that aligns more closely with user expectations. Essential components include small, adaptable teams, visual development tools, and ongoing communication to facilitate prompt issue resolution.
